Stereo-Vision: Head-Centric Coding of Retinal Signals

نویسندگان

  • Raymond van Ee
  • Casper J. Erkelens
چکیده

Stereo-vision is generally considered to provide information about depth in a visual scene derived from disparities in the positions of an image on the two eyes; a new study has found evidence that retinal-image coding relative to the head is also important.
